Understanding Hand Rankings and Starting Hands

Before diving into the more coordination compound aspects of online poker, it is essential to have a firm grasp of hand rankings, as this forms the foundation of all poker variants. The standard hierarchy, from highest to lowest, begins with the royal flush (ace, king, queen, jack, ten of the same suit of clothes), followed by a consecutive flush, four of a kind, total house, flush, straight, three of a kind, two pair, one pair, and finally the high card. Beginners often find it helpful to memorise this order before playing, as it dictates the strength of your hand in every round. Equally important is apprehension which starting hands are worth playing. In Texas Hold’em, for instance, premium hands like pocket aces, kings, queens, and ace-king suited are strong and should be raised pre-flop. Conversely, weak hands such as 2-7 offsuit or 3-8 offsuit are best folded to avoid costly mistakes. Position at the table also plays a crucial role; being in late position allows you to see how opponents human activity before you make a decision, giving you a strategic advantage. By combining knowledge of hand rankings with smartness starting hand selection, you can significantly improve your chances of winning, whether you are playing in a cash game or a tournament.

Cash Games vs Tournaments: Key Differences

When exploring digital poker, you will quickly encounter two primary formats: cash in games and tournaments. Cash games, often called ring games, involve playing with real money chips that have real cash value. You can join or leave a cash game at any time, and blinds remain frozen, making the gait consistent. This format suits players who prefer a steady, low-risk approach where bankroll management is straightforward. In contrast, tournaments demand a fixed buy-in and involve a set number of players competing for a prize pool that grows as more players register. The blinds increase at regular intervals, forcing activity and eventually eliminating players until single remains. Tournaments offer the allure of large payouts for a small entry fee, but they demand patience and adaptability due to the escalating screen structure. Sit-and-go tournaments are smaller, usually with 6 to 9 players, and begin as soon as the table is full. Multi-table tournaments, or MTTS, can have hundreds or even thousands of participants, with belatedly registration allowing players to join after the start. Understanding these differences is crucial for choosing the format that aligns with your playing style and goals.

Variants of Poker and Video Poker Options

While Texas Hold’em dominates the internet poker landscape, other variants offer unique challenges and opportunities. Omaha is similar to Hold’em but with four hole cards instead of two, and players must use exactly two of them along with three community cards to make a hand. This leads to more action and bigger pots, as hands are generally stronger.

What is the difference between a poker tournament and a cash offering?

In a tournament, players buy in for a fixed amount and vie until one player wins all chips, with prizes awarded based on finishing place. In a cash game, chips represent cash money, and you can join or leave at any time, with each hand played for actual stakes.

How do online poker rooms work?

Online poker rooms are digital platforms where players link to play poker over the internet. They offer various offering formats, manage player funds, and make use of random number generators to ensure fair dealing.

What are the basic hand rankings in poker?

From highest to lowest: Royal Flush, Straight Flush, Four of a Variety, Full House, Flush, Straight, Three of a Kind, Two Pair, One Pair, and High Card. Memorising these is essential for beginners.
